CAVEMAN – The Show in Hamburg
One night, the incomprehensible happens: Tom meets his ancestor from the Stone Age in the "magical underwear circle". It's a momentous encounter, because the sympathetic caveman has some insightful advice for Tom. He now knows the difference between men and women: men are hunters and women gatherers - more than 10,000 years of evolution have not changed this.

CAVEMAN knows first hand what the average man has always suspected: men and women simply don't fit together! Tom receives the order to spread his knowledge. With his considerable need to communicate, his curiosity and his dry humour, he brings the 'little' difference closer to us. We get to know the unknown universe of his girlfriend Heike and that of all gatherers - the mysterious world of shopping, household and sex. But Tom also closely observed the hunters' habitat and way of life: How much fulfilment "sitting around without talking" can bring, or why television should be rated as work.
